The main differences between strudel and ricotta
- Strudel is richer than ricotta in iron, vitamin B12, vitamin B6, vitamin B3, vitamin B1, vitamin B2, vitamin A, and folate.
- Daily need coverage for iron for strudel is 69% higher.
- Strudel contains 51 times more vitamin B3 than ricotta. Strudel contains 5.3mg of vitamin B3, while ricotta contains 0.104mg.
- Ricotta contains less sodium.
- Ricotta has a lower glycemic index than strudel.
Food types used in this article are KELLOGG'S, EGGO, Wafflers, Strawberry Strudel and Cheese, ricotta, whole milk.
